Output 66608784c22d580c4cf57cc1b767a0912c6d63115e9bb80fa4311c738fee89c4:1

value
1364145
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cbad59832c8600fbcfc906ec23fb45d2913917ba OP_EQUALVERIFY OP_CHECKSIG
address
1KZwqVF7gGDUrYbA1azexAhMebriZAca6b
transaction
66608784c22d580c4cf57cc1b767a0912c6d63115e9bb80fa4311c738fee89c4
confirmations
253721
spent
true